Output 80a833100efa16548c463e9baee54cb66c451befcdd3c42dbc62a03975137717:1

value
259396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8281af4dd69b98c931da000ef954b59ea185b58 OP_EQUAL
address
3JUkJQUaWgB43v9AAUWWj3k1AiwHbHqECs
transaction
80a833100efa16548c463e9baee54cb66c451befcdd3c42dbc62a03975137717
confirmations
361953
spent
true